Cranbrook Evening Auxiliary
The. May meeting of the Cranbrook
igirening Auxiliary was held at the
I home of Mrs. Frank Smith, •Thurs-
Say, evening, May 10th, with 14
members present. The leader Mrs,
Joe Smith, chose her theme "Open
the Door", Bev. Smith led in
prayer send • read the meditation
The first and last verses of hymn 58
were sung, • The scripttre, Revel-
ations 2, verses 14,20, were read in
unison. The meeting was then
turned over to the president, The
minutes of the last meeting were
read and approved. The roll call was
answered with . an aritiele for the
bazaar. The correspopeence was
read. Moved by Noble, .seconded
by Kay that we don't send a delegate
to Belleville A, report on the Mait-
land Presbyterial at Liucknow. May
16th and Kinloss Training School
for C.O.C.. was given by Marilyn,
En eel,. Plans were made for the next
meeting. The collection was • taken
by Helen Smith. The topic "Blessed
are the 'Peacemakers.' for they shall
he called the children of God" was
'taken by Helen. Cameron. The first
and last verses of hymn 9 was sung,
The leader closedthe meeting Trith
prayer, Lunch was served by the
hostess assisted by Mrs, Jack
'Knight and Mrs, Jim Knight.

The May meeting, of the Brussels
School Board was held May 9, with
all members present. The minutes of
the previous meeting were read
and adopted on metion by .Tare
MeWhiter and Howard sternord,
- Carried.
Chairman . Kennedy reported
favourable results of their trip to
Stra;tford Teachers' College, Miss
Metzger of Hanover has beon
engaged 'to fill the vacancy on thei
local staff caused by the resignat-
ion of Mrs, Louise Porter
Moves by Ted MacLean and,
seconded by Jack Me,Whirter a
notice for tenders for furnace oil
for ensuing year be placed in the
Post.
